Finally, VP Osibanjo’s whereabouts revealed

Vice President Yemi Osinbajo, on Saturday, gave an insight into his whereabouts in the past few weeks.
Onyxnews Nigeria reports that Osinbajo, who spoke through his spokesperson, Akande Laolu, revealed that he has been attending to official issues on how to improve the economy of Nigeria.
This reliable online news platform understands that Laolu, in an Instagram post said that after he was contacted on Osinbajo’s whereabouts, called on Nigerians to ignore untrue claims regarding President Muhammadu Buhari and the Vice President’s whereabouts.
He recalled that the Vice President on Thursday met with the Governor of Central Bank, CBN, Kaduna State Governor, and some Ministers through video conferencing.
Laolu said: “With my boss the Vice President last night in his office, reviewing some of the events of the week.
“By the way continue to ignore professional fake news conduits who share fictions about the whereabouts of the president and his Vice, Osinbajo.
“The critical mass of our people see both the president and the VP regularly on TV, hear about them regularly on radio, read from them in the press and observe their activities regularly on the social media.
“For instance, on Thursday the VP held a videoconferencing meeting that included the governor of Kaduna, Power and Finance Ministers, the CBN governor and other government officials on how to expand electricity in the country.
“The work goes on, and Nigeria will surely prevail. We will do it together.”
Osinbajo not being present in public view for the past weeks had sparked some form of conspiracy that he may have contracted the ravaging virus known as COVID-19 or he’s in other trouble.
On the other hand, Buhari’s Special Adviser on Media and Publicity, Femi Adesina, had said that Osinbajo has been busy working with the Economic Sustainability Committee.
